Transaction 66fcbffb222481fb087d71e4148b53f1524d350672dd55b297b0b7c74ea2568a
1 Input
1 Output
-
66fcbffb222481fb087d71e4148b53f1524d350672dd55b297b0b7c74ea2568a:0
- value
- 35761982
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a74705fc4b5e26885094b0ced3a96920297ddb2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16L5gSvoiruRvB7ZarJv8bXwUAbpwuJ5gS